dmesg.fr:~#

display message

Gestion des fichiers image ISO NRG BIN CUE sous Linux

AcetoneISO : le couteau suisse de la manipulation de fichiers images CD / DVD

acetoneiso logoAcetoneISO est un logiciel de manipulation de fichiers images CD / DVD très puissant. En plus de monter et de convertir des fichiers images CD, il propose également :

- la gravure d'images CD / DVD
- l'extraction vidéo, par exemple ripper un DVD vidéo en format Xvid
- le transfert de vidéo vers YouTube
- l'extraction audio à partir d'une piste vidéo

Installation

Ouvrez un Terminal et tapez :

apt-get install acetoneiso


Utilisation

AcetoneISO se trouve dans le menu "Applications" -> "Son et vidéo".
L'utilisation d'AcetoneISO n'est pas décrite dans cet article, car l'interface graphique est suffisamment intuitive pour que tout utilisateur s'en sorte :-) Tous les détails concernant l'utilisation : http://www.acetoneteam.org/

AcetoneISO capture


En ligne de commande

Monter un fichier image CD-ROM .ISO ou .NRG


lecteur cd-romVous disposez d’un fichier image .iso ou .nrg d’un CD-ROM et vous souhaitez afficher son contenu.

Pour cela, il faut d’abord créer un point de montage, puis « monter » votre fichier image CD-ROM.

Ouvrez un Terminal et créez un point de montage :

mkdir /media/imgiso


Monter un fichier .iso


mount -o loop -t iso9660 votre_fichier.iso /media/imgiso

Monter un fichier .nrg

losetup /dev/loop0 votre_fichier.nrg -o 307200

mount /dev/loop0 /media/imgiso


Créer une image disque (fichier .iso) à partir d'un CD-ROM

Insérez un CD-ROM dans votre lecteur, ouvrez un Terminal et tapez :

dd if=/dev/cdrom of=image_cd.iso


Extraire une image disque (fichier .iso) sur une clé USB

Insérez une clé USB. Ouvrez un Terminal et tapez :

fdisk -l


Repérez votre clé USB (exemple avec une clé USB de 4 Go) :

Disk /dev/sdf: 4023 MB, 4023385600 bytes
124 heads, 62 sectors/track, 1022 cylinders
Units = cylinders of 7688 * 512 = 3936256 bytes
Disk identifier: 0x7318740c

Device Boot      Start         End      Blocks   Id  System
/dev/sdf1 1        1022     3928537    b  W95 FAT32


Tapez :

umount /dev/sdf1
dd if=nom_fichier_iso.iso of=/dev/sdf



Convertir un fichier image CD-ROM .BIN .CUE au format .ISO

BChunk vous permet de convertir des fichiers image CD-ROM au format .BIN .CUE vers le format .ISO.


Installation

Ouvrez un Terminal et tapez :

apt-get install bchunk


Utilisation

Pour convertir le couple de fichiers .BIN .CUE en fichier .ISO, tapez :

bchunk votre_fichier.bin votre_fichier.cue nouveau_fichier.iso


Monter un fichier image ISO en 2 clics avec Nautilus

Pour monter et démonter un fichier .ISO directement depuis Nautilus, nous allons créer 2 scripts, puis les appeler dans Nautilus avec un simple clic droit de souris.


Pré-requis

Les paquets "sudo", "gksu" et "zenity" doivent être installés. Si ce n'est pas le cas, ouvrez un Terminal et tapez :

apt-get install sudo gksu zenity


Préparation des scripts pour Nautilus


Script de montage d'un fichier image .ISO

Faites un copier / coller dans un fichier que vous appelerez iso_file_mount.sh :

#!/bin/bash
# Montage de fichiers ISO avec Nautilus

gksudo -k /bin/echo "Saisissez votre mot de passe"

BASENAME=`basename $NAUTILUS_SCRIPT_SELECTED_FILE_PATHS`

if [ -e "/media/$BASENAME" ]
then
zenity --info --title "Montage fichier ISO" --text "$BASENAME déjà monté"
exit 0
fi

sudo mkdir "/media/$BASENAME"

if sudo mount -o loop -t iso9660 $NAUTILUS_SCRIPT_SELECTED_FILE_PATHS "/media/$BASENAME"
then
nautilus /media/"$BASENAME" --no-desktop
exit 0
else
sudo rmdir "/media/$BASENAME"
zenity --error --title "Montage fichier ISO" --text "Impossible de monter $BASENAME!"
exit 1
fi



Script de démontage d'un fichier image .ISO

Faites un copier / coller dans un fichier que vous appelerez iso_file_umount.sh :

#!/bin/bash
# Démontage de fichiers ISO avec Nautilus

gksudo -k /bin/echo "Saisissez votre mot de passe"

BASENAME=`basename $NAUTILUS_SCRIPT_SELECTED_FILE_PATHS`

test -e "/media/$BASENAME"
if [ $? != 0 ]
then
zenity --info --title "Démontage fichier ISO" --text "$BASENAME non monté"
exit 0
fi

sudo umount "/media/$BASENAME"
sudo rmdir "/media/$BASENAME"

zenity --info --text "$BASENAME démonté."

exit 0



Rendez les 2 scripts exécutables et copiez-les dans le répertoire de scripts de Nautilus :

chmod +x iso_file*
cp iso_file* ~/.gnome2/nautilus-scripts


Montage d'un fichier .ISO dans Nautilus

Dans Nautilus, sélectionnez le fichier .ISO que vous souhaitez monter.
Faites un clic-droit, choisissez "Scripts", puis "iso_file_mount.sh".
Saisissez votre mot de passe.
Votre fichier .ISO est monté.


mount iso file nautilus


Démontage d'un fichier .ISO dans Nautilus

Sélectionnez simplement le volume que vous avez monté précédemment, puis clic droit, "Scripts", "iso_file_umount.sh" :

unmount iso file nautilus



Copyright dmesg.fr - All Rights Reserved.